Valorization of chicken gastrointestinal fat into low sulfur biodiesel by pneumatic sparging assisted two-step transesterifications followed by distillation: A techno-economic study

Abstract
En 中文
• Pneumatic sparging-assisted two-step transesterification was developed. • The highest biodiesel yield of 99.50% with 10 ppm sulfur content was achieved. • Biodiesel minimum selling price calculated at 0.967 $/kg with 2.26-year payback. • Sulfur content was decreased 84.8% after the second transesterification. • Sustainable feedstock use reduces environmental impact and valorizes waste.
